1,014,104 is a composite number, even.
1,014,104 (one million fourteen thousand one hundred four) is an even 7-digit number. It is a composite number with 48 divisors, and factors as 2³ × 7² × 13 × 199. Its proper divisors sum to 1,379,896,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xF7958.
